How much does it cost to rent a home in Holyoak?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Holyoak 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,101 | $1,500 | $2,450 |
| Holyoak 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,702 | $1,600 | $3,600 |
| Holyoak 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,819 | $1,870 | $3,465 |
| Holyoak 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,800 | $3,800 | $3,800 |
| Holyoak 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,995 | $3,995 | $3,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Holyoak
What type of rentals are currently available in Holyoak?
There are currently 44 Apartments for Rent in Holyoak, CO with pricing that ranges from $1,000 to $3,939. There are also 70 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Holyoak ranging from $600 to $3,995.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Holyoak?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Holyoak ranges from $600 to $3,995 with an average monthly rent of $2,604.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Holyoak?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Holyoak range from $1,850 to $3,939,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,600 to $3,600.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,870 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,700.
